Iowa to Illinois Car Shipping (2026 Cost Guide)

Quick answer: The average cost to ship a car 258 miles from Iowa to Illinois ranges from $436 to $564 and takes one–four days depending on factors like the transport type and season. For a more detailed quote, use our car shipping cost calculator.

How we chose the best car shipping companies

We analyzed 2,400 car shipping companies nationally and evaluated and rated them based on key factors using our unique system of methodology.

Here’s what we considered:

  • Standard services: We looked at the types and variety of services each company provides. This includes whether they offer open transport, enclosed transport, or both. We also rated companies based on whether they have door-to-door shipping or just terminal pickup and delivery and the kinds of vehicles they ship. Companies that move RVs, motorcycles, and other specialty vehicles scored higher than those that just ship cars.
  • Add-on services: We gave additional points to companies that provide special optional services like expedited shipping, guaranteed pickup times, car washes, and rental car reimbursement.
  • Customer satisfaction: We analyzed consumer reviews on multiple major platforms, such as Yelp, Google, and Trustpilot to see whether a car shipping company delivers services promptly with good communication and within the estimated cost. We also evaluated each company’s standing within the car shipping industry as a whole by confirming U.S. Department of Transportation (USDOT) licensure and checked their membership in — and reputation with — trade associations.
  • Availability: We awarded points to each company based on their service areas. Companies that are available in Alaska and Hawaii, in addition to the continental U.S., scored higher than those that just service the Lower 48 or fewer states.
  • Scheduling and payment: We reviewed the ease with which customers can schedule services and estimate their costs through accurate quotes, price matching, flat-rate pricing, and other perks. Car shippers that give binding quotes or a price-lock promise got more positive rankings than those that are not as transparent with pricing.

Iowa to Illinois auto transport costs and transit times

The following tables provide estimated costs and shipping times for cars transported between key cities in Iowa and Illinois. Average distances are close to 258 miles, with delivery usually taking one–four days.

Cost to ship a car from Des Moines, IA to Illinois

From Iowa to Illinois Cost Distance Estimated transit time
Des Moines, IA to Chicago, IL $499 – $710 333 miles 1 – 4 days
Des Moines, IA to Aurora, IL $471 – $617 297 miles 1 – 4 days
Des Moines, IA to Joliet, IL $494 – $681 308 miles 1 – 4 days
Des Moines, IA to Naperville, IL $475 – $688 307 miles 1 – 4 days
Des Moines, IA to Rockford, IL $457 – $636 287 miles 1 – 4 days

Cost to ship a car from Cedar Rapids, IA to Illinois

From Iowa to Illinois Cost Distance Estimated transit time
Cedar Rapids, IA to Chicago, IL $448 – $612 247 miles 1 – 4 days
Cedar Rapids, IA to Aurora, IL $422 – $532 211 miles 1 – 4 days
Cedar Rapids, IA to Joliet, IL $458 – $558 221 miles 1 – 4 days
Cedar Rapids, IA to Naperville, IL $445 – $598 220 miles 1 – 4 days
Cedar Rapids, IA to Rockford, IL $359 – $530 164 miles 1 – 4 days

Cost to ship a car from Davenport, IA to Illinois

From Iowa to Illinois Cost Distance Estimated transit time
Davenport, IA to Chicago, IL $367 – $533 172 miles 1 – 4 days
Davenport, IA to Aurora, IL $329 – $527 136 miles 1 – 4 days
Davenport, IA to Joliet, IL $344 – $480 141 miles 1 – 4 days
Davenport, IA to Naperville, IL $348 – $516 146 miles 1 – 4 days
Davenport, IA to Rockford, IL $335 – $502 126 miles 1 – 4 days

Cost to ship a car from Sioux City, IA to Illinois

From Iowa to Illinois Cost Distance Estimated transit time
Sioux City, IA to Chicago, IL $587 – $883 477 miles 1 – 4 days
Sioux City, IA to Aurora, IL $607 – $791 474 miles 1 – 4 days
Sioux City, IA to Joliet, IL $606 – $815 485 miles 1 – 4 days
Sioux City, IA to Naperville, IL $593 – $892 484 miles 1 – 4 days
Sioux City, IA to Rockford, IL $553 – $780 392 miles 1 – 4 days

Cost to ship a car from Iowa City, IA to Illinois

From Iowa to Illinois Cost Distance Estimated transit time
Iowa City, IA to Chicago, IL $428 – $581 222 miles 1 – 4 days
Iowa City, IA to Aurora, IL $390 – $512 186 miles 1 – 4 days
Iowa City, IA to Joliet, IL $417 – $569 196 miles 1 – 4 days
Iowa City, IA to Naperville, IL $409 – $548 196 miles 1 – 4 days
Iowa City, IA to Rockford, IL $367 – $512 176 miles 1 – 4 days

Shipping an SUV or truck from Iowa to Illinois

SUVs, trucks, and vans typically cost more to ship than smaller cars because of their size and weight.

For a larger vehicle going from Iowa to Illinois, the price usually falls between $545 and $705.

Factors that affect car shipping costs from Iowa to Illinois

When moving your vehicle from the Hawkeye State to the Land of Lincoln, several factors can affect the total shipping cost:

  • Type of transport: Options include open carriers, enclosed transport, and top-loading. Open carriers are less expensive, while enclosed transport is best for luxury or classic cars. See our comparison of open vs. enclosed auto transport for more details.
  • Vehicle size and type: Larger vehicles that weigh more are costlier to ship. This directly affects pricing for transport to Illinois.
  • Distance and route: The journey from Iowa to Illinois spans approximately 258 miles, influencing fuel and labor costs. The longer the distance, the bigger the price tag.
  • Time of the year: Demand peaks in summer and during holiday seasons. Moves from Iowa around these times usually come with higher costs.
  • Fuel prices: Fluctuating fuel prices can significantly affect transport costs. This is an important consideration given the distance between Iowa and Illinois and the varying gas prices across the country.
  • Delivery expectations: Shippers may offer lower pricing if your schedule allows for flexible delivery dates. Standard delivery takes one–four days, while expedited service costs more.

Illinois vehicle regulations you need to know

Once you arrive in Illinois, registering your vehicle and ensuring it’s road-legal will require a few specific actions. The list below outlines the most important requirements.

  • Car insurance requirements: The liability insurance minimums for Illinois are $25,000 bodily injury liability per person, $50,000 bodily injury liability per accident, and $20,000 property damage liability per accident.
  • Vehicle inspection: In Illinois, emissions inspections are mandatory on a yearly basis for eligible vehicles in the Chicago and East St. Louis metropolitan areas. The Illinois Environmental Protection Agency conducts tests on automobiles before residents can renew their vehicle registration with the Secretary of State's office.
  • Driver’s license: Even if your out-of-state driver's license is valid, you must still pass a vision test and written exam if you are moving to Illinois. Within 90 days of becoming a resident in the state, you must convert your license to an Illinois non-commercial license.
  • Additional taxes: According to Illinois law, the recipient or buyer of any vehicle transferred within the state must complete a Private Party Vehicle Tax Transaction form (form RUT-50) and pay the sales tax for the car within 30 days of the transfer of ownership.

FAQ

Does someone have to be present when you ship a car for pickup in Iowa and delivery in Illinois?

Most companies will require that an adult of at least 18 years of age be present when picking up your car in Iowa and when dropping it off in Illinois.

Do you need car insurance when shipping your car from Iowa to Illinois?

If you’re not driving the vehicle from Iowa to Illinois, you aren't required to have typical car insurance. Your car hauler should have adequate insurance if an accident happened on the drive to Illinois, which you should verify before loading your car in Iowa.

If you’re driving your car at all in either state, you should understand the requirements. Iowa requires minimum liability insurance, covering $20,000 for individual injury or death, $40,000 for multiple individuals, and $15,000 for property damage in an accident.

The liability insurance minimums for Illinois are $25,000 bodily injury liability per person, $50,000 bodily injury liability per accident, and $20,000 property damage liability per accident.

How long does it take to ship a car from Iowa to Illinois?

Car shipping companies can travel about 500 miles per day. The trip from Iowa to Illinois is about 258 miles, and that’s as fast as about 1 day. However, most car transport companies will take one to four days to travel from Iowa to Illinois.

Will I be required to have a vehicle inspection in either state?

In Iowa, car owners are not obligated to undergo emissions, VIN, or safety inspections.

In Illinois, emissions inspections are mandatory on a yearly basis for eligible vehicles in the Chicago and East St. Louis metropolitan areas. The Illinois Environmental Protection Agency conducts tests on automobiles before residents can renew their vehicle registration with the Secretary of State's office.

If I have a driver’s license in Iowa, will I need one in Illinois?

Even if your out-of-state driver's license is valid, you must still pass a vision test and written exam if you are moving to Illinois. Within 90 days of becoming a resident in the state, you must convert your license to an Illinois non-commercial license.

If I bought a car in Iowa, will I be required to pay sales tax in Illinois after shipping it there?

It’s important to understand any tax implications if you’re having a car shipped from Iowa to Illinois after purchasing it.

According to Illinois law, the recipient or buyer of any vehicle transferred within the state must complete a Private Party Vehicle Tax Transaction form (form RUT-50) and pay the sales tax for the car within 30 days of the transfer of ownership.

We recommend that you always check for updated tax information in both Iowa and Illinois to avoid any hidden costs.
